Dhanora
Dhanora is a village located in Pandhana tehsil of Khandwa district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 24km away from sub-district headquarter Pandhana (tehsildar office) and 35km away from district headquarter Khandwa. As per 2009 stats, Dhanora village is also a gram panchayat.

About Dhanora
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dhanora is 506153. The village spans a total geographical area of 658.72 hectares. Khandwa is nearest town to Dhanora village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 35km away.

Population of Dhanora
Below is a concise population overview of Dhanora as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,435 | 731 | 704 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 241 | 110 | 131 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 115 | 58 | 57 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 478 | 236 | 242 |
Literate Population | 776 | 484 | 292 |
Illiterate Population | 659 | 247 | 412 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Dhanora village:
- The total population of Dhanora village is around 1,435, including approximately 731 males and 704 females, with a sex ratio of 963 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 241 children aged 0–6 years in Dhanora village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Dhanora village has 115 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 478 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Dhanora village is about 54.08%, with male literacy at 66.21% and female literacy at 41.48%.
- There are around 258 households in Dhanora village.
Connectivity of Dhanora
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dhanora. As per the 2011 stats, Dhanora had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
